💰 Salary Guide: Retail Store Jobs in Luxembourg – 2025
| Job Role | Monthly Salary (EUR) | Monthly in SAR |
|---|---|---|
| Cashier | €1,800 – €2,200 | SAR 7,200 – 8,800 |
| Shelf Stocker | €1,700 – €2,000 | SAR 6,800 – 8,000 |
| Sales Associate | €2,000 – €2,500 | SAR 8,000 – 10,000 |
| Store Supervisor | €2,500 – €3,200 | SAR 10,000 – 12,800 |
| Inventory Coordinator | €2,200 – €2,700 | SAR 8,800 – 10,800 |
🕒 Most retail jobs involve rotating shifts (day/night) and paid overtime, especially during weekends and holidays.
🛂 Work Visa Sponsorship for Retail Jobs in Luxembourg
✅ Long-Stay Visa (Type D) + Residence & Work Authorization
If you’re a non-EU citizen, you’ll need:
-
A job offer from a licensed Luxembourg employer
-
Employer submits application for authorization to stay and work
-
Once approved, you apply for a Type D visa at the Luxembourg embassy in your country
-
After arriving, you must register your residence and obtain a national ID card
Your visa is typically valid for 1 year, renewable, and can lead to permanent residency after 5 years.

❌ Applying without checking if the employer is licensed for visa sponsorship
❌ Accepting job offers without a written contract
❌ Working without insurance — illegal in Luxembourg
❌ Paying agents for fake “guaranteed” retail jobs
❌ Not learning basic workplace French phrases
